1873 BENJAMIN WAUGH. A Plea Against Juvenile Imprisonment & Child Slavery. Rare. Puritan he is an ArabA superb copy of a scarce work calling for reform of the criminal and orphanage system in England as it tended to sustain a near slave work force for large corporations, produce more criminals, and lead to lives of ill repute [i. e. prostitution and sex trafficking for the young ladies].
